## Tax-Rate Lookup Cache

The Ledgerpine cache layer stores jurisdiction tax rates for 24 hours and must be flushed as part of every release that touches the rates schema. The flush endpoint lives on the internal Ledgerpine admin API and requires a service-level credential; release managers should trigger it immediately after migration completes. Include the following key in the request header.

gateway credential: kto23_LX9A4ys6i4nzHtpOLNLodKK

Ticket #2931 — Timezone drift in CSV exports. Product: Ledgervane Reports by Quillmark Analytics. Steps: 1) Set account timezone to a UTC+5:45 region. 2) Schedule a daily export at 09:00 local. 3) Download the resulting CSV. Observed: timestamps rendered in UTC with no offset column, shifting records across date boundaries. Expected: localized timestamps with explicit offsets. Security note: the export endpoint also omits timezone in audit logs. Reproduce on staging using the bearer token below.

session JWT of yawep-yawep = eyJhbGciOiJIUzI1NiIsInR5cCI6IkpXVCJ9.eyJzdWIiOiI3pWF3_In0.aXYsHiog

Welcome to the Bouncewell team. The bounce processor polls the Herrondale mail relay every two minutes, classifies hard and soft bounces, and suppresses repeat offenders. All relay traffic is TLS-only, and suppression lists are encrypted at rest. Before your first local run, the relay auth token must be set; add this line to `.env.local`:

env line for yahag-kajog: VAULT_KEY13=e1c568d90102d

# Ledger Archive Transport

Paper ledgers from the Carnwick branch move to the Delvehurst archive vault monthly. Coordinator duties: confirm sealed crates against the manifest, assign one driver per run, no shared loads. Crates ride in the cab-adjacent bay, strapped, out of direct sun. No overnight stops. On arrival, archive staff count crates before the driver departs; discrepancies halt the run. Drivers sign the custody sheet at both ends. Every driver must execute the hand-over instruction stated below.

handover note for yagef-bagep: the drudor pelius courier leaves the kasdor zorvan norir ledger at gate 8016 under passcode 755406